Stewart Robson: 'Chelsea boss Antonio Conte would be great fit at Arsenal'

Former Arsenal midfielder Stewart Robson has claimed that Chelsea manager Antonio Conte would be a "great" replacement for Arsene Wenger. The Frenchman's position at the Emirates has come under fire once again following Sunday's 3-0 defeat to Manchester City in the EFL Cup final. The Gunners limped their way through the game at Wembley, and the club are outsiders to finish in the top four as they sit 10 points adrift in the Premier League table. Robson believes that the saviour could be Conte, whose own future has made headlines over the last few months, despite guiding the Blues to title glory in his first season in the 2016-17 campaign.
